About the Team

The IT & Infrastructure Engineering team builds and operates the foundational systems that power 1X employees, robots, manufacturing environments, and operational infrastructure. We focus on creating secure, scalable, and highly automated environments that enable engineering and operations teams to move quickly and reliably.

Linux systems and endpoint infrastructure are critical to how 1X develops, deploys, and operates robotics systems across engineering labs, manufacturing floors, and corporate environments.

Your Charter

Own and scale the Linux device management infrastructure across 1X’s rapidly growing robotics organization. This role is responsible for building secure, automated, and reliable Linux fleet management solutions that support engineering productivity, operational scalability, and strong security posture across development and production environments.

Key Outcomes

  • Design and scale Linux device management systems supporting engineering, robotics, and operational environments across the company

  • Improve fleet reliability, security, and operational efficiency through automation, centralized management, and configuration standardization

  • Develop scalable provisioning, patch management, compliance, and monitoring workflows across Linux endpoints and infrastructure

  • Partner cross-functionally with Security, IT, Robotics, and Infrastructure teams to improve endpoint security and operational readiness

  • Reduce manual operational overhead by implementing automation tooling, self-service workflows, and infrastructure-as-code methodologies

Key Competencies

  • Deep expertise managing Linux endpoints and infrastructure at scale

  • Strong automation and scripting skills using Python, Bash, or similar tooling

  • Experience with configuration management and device orchestration platforms such as Ansible, Puppet, Chef, or Salt

  • Strong understanding of endpoint security, patch management, compliance, and systems hardening best practices

  • Excellent troubleshooting and operational problem-solving skills across distributed systems environments

Minimum Requirements

  • 7+ years of experience in Linux systems engineering, device management, infrastructure engineering, or related technical domains

  • Strong hands-on experience administering Linux systems in enterprise or production environments

  • Experience with device provisioning, endpoint management, systems automation, and configuration management tooling

  • Strong scripting/programming experience using Python, Bash, or equivalent languages

  • Experience supporting cloud infrastructure environments such as AWS, GCP, or Azure

Preferred Skills

  • Experience supporting robotics, manufacturing, operational technology (OT), or hardware engineering environments

  • Familiarity with endpoint detection and response (EDR), identity management, and device trust frameworks

  • Experience with CI/CD systems, developer infrastructure, or Kubernetes environments

  • Exposure to zero trust security principles and infrastructure compliance frameworks

  • Experience operating in high-growth startup environments
